加密貨幣交易所 加密貨幣交易所
Ctrl+D 加密貨幣交易所
ads

印鈔機的秘密:USDT增發最全技術細節首次披露_SDT:usdt幣交易怎么玩

Author:

Time:1900/1/1 0:00:00

近日,聽說以太坊上的泰達幣頻繁被增發。本著學習的目的在etherscan上審計了泰達幣的智能合約源碼以及USDT增發相關的調用事件,本文記錄一下分析過程。以下是TetherToken智能合約的USDT增發函數:可以看到增發USDT需要TetherToken合約的owner賬戶調用issue(uint)增發函數進行,增發成功后還會拋出Issue(amount)增發事件。再看下最近的增發記錄截圖:

TransactionHash:0xdd108cd36fbeaab03b29ac46d465ad9824618d683268681d3206bd78302e0d71

2021年一月Tether凈印鈔約合86.16億USDT、總市值突破263.7億美元:據Tokenview區塊瀏覽器數據顯示:一月USDT新印鈔111.16億枚,新銷毀25億枚,共計凈印鈔86.16億枚。其中以太坊上印鈔數量約51.16億,波場鏈上印鈔約35億,新增印鈔共計流入5家交易所,按流入量排名分別為Binance-15.8億枚、Bitfinex-14.7億枚、Nexo-1.45億枚、OKEX-3984萬枚、Huobi-2301萬枚。當前USDT總市值已超過263.7億美元。[2021/2/1 18:36:38]

可以看到在上圖交易詳情中并沒有調用TetherToken合約的issue(uint)增發函數,而是調用了MultiSigWallet合約的confirmTransaction(uint)函數完成的增發操作。需要注意以下兩點:

Tether在以太坊網絡新增印鈔3億枚USDT(已授權未發行):據Whale Alert數據,北京時間01月01日19:16,Tether公司在以太坊網絡新增發3億枚USDT。交易哈希為180e333633de85488e61c595f711caa44a598aa8b73f88e517c5e2593f6e26cb。

對此,Tether首席技術官Paolo Ardoino表示,以太坊網絡補充了3億枚USDT的庫存。這是一筆已授權但未發行的交易,意味著該金額將用作下一次發行請求的庫存。[2021/1/1 16:14:06]

TetherToken合約調用分析

近一周Tether新增印鈔5.82億USDT:據Tokenview穩定幣數據顯示,截至今日14時,當前USDT鏈上流通量約合86.07億枚。近一周Tether新贈印鈔5.82億USDT。通過Tether Treasury新發行了5.49億USDT,Treasury地址余額剩1.97億USDT尚未發行。[2020/5/4]

我們先看看MultiSigWallet合約的confirmTransaction(uint)函數的實現

調用confirmTransaction(uint)函數確認并執行交易需要滿足以下條件

億萬富翁Mark Cuban:如果經濟因大規模印鈔而崩潰 比特幣可能受益:在最新一期播客節目中,摩根溪聯合創始人Anthony Pompliano問美國億萬富翁Mark Cuban,他怎樣才能承認比特幣是寶貴的資產。Cuban表示,比特幣必須非常容易使用,每個人都能理解,只有在這種情況下,才能說它是一種替代黃金的價值儲存手段。而且就交易方式而言,要把比特幣轉換成任何東西都得依賴法定貨幣,而不是直接使用。雖然Mark Cuban仍舊認為比特幣甚至不如香蕉有價值,但他表示,如果經濟因大規模印鈔而崩潰,每個人都失去了一切,那么比特幣可能會受益。此外他還提到自己目前擁有價值130美元的BTC。此前Cuban曾透露,他沒有任何加密貨幣,而且愿意保持這種狀態。(U.today)[2020/4/15]

submitTransaction(address,uint,bytes)會調用到合約內部的addTransaction(address,uint,bytes)函數,其實現如下:

最終一次完整的提交->確認操作流程如下:1、調用submitTransaction(address,uint,bytes)函數提交事務并傳入參數:contract-address、eth-value、payload。注意:提交事務包含一次事務確認。依次發送Submission事件->Confirmation事件。2、調用confirmTransaction(uint)確認并執行事務,需要3個不同的owner賬戶完成最終的確認。依次發送Confirmation事件->執行payload所產生的事件->Execution事件。TetherToken跨合約調用如下圖所示:

USDT增發分析

繼續看這筆增發交易的調用事件,正好滿足調用confirmTransaction(uint)函數所產生的事件。

通過查詢transactionId即可看到調用參數

轉換成以下偽代碼:

那么Bitfinex:MultiSig2地址的USDT是哪來的呢?根據transactionId繼續向前追蹤一個事務即可找到真正為Bitfinex:MultiSig2地址增發USDT的交易:

轉換成以下偽代碼:

TransactionHash:0xb467ea92b5c0095b1a96f35eb466b239c13e5b0b3f493e3e452f832d99830d6b這才是真正為Bitfinex:MultiSig2地址增發USDT的操作。USDT增發如下圖所示:

總結

可以看到,USDT的增發需要通過MultiSigWallet跨合約調用才能完成。而MultiSigWallet智能合約存在多個owner用戶,完成一次跨合約調用需要至少3個owner的確認。這種增發機制在一定程度上杜絕了當某一owner賬戶丟失或被盜時USDT被惡意增發的安全隱患。

Tags:SDTUSDTUSDIONimtoken里的usdt提現人民幣教程usdt幣交易怎么玩usdt幣圈最新消息Professional Fighters League Fan Token

歐易交易所
Pantera Capital:如果歷史重演,比特幣有望在2021年8月達到11.5萬美元_比特幣:ANC

編者按:本文來自巴比特資訊,作者:DanMorehead,編譯:夕雨,星球日報經授權發布。這是一個非常令人痛苦的,令人費解的時刻.

1900/1/1 0:00:00
傳奇投資人Paul Tudor Jones:我賭比特幣_比特幣:ludos幣價格

加密貨幣市場又恢復了生機!比特幣價格在今早突破10000美元關口,從3800美元到10000美元,比特幣在不到兩個月的時間內收復失地,市場情緒已經快速由看空轉變為看多.

1900/1/1 0:00:00
OKB生態建設4月月報_OKB:korthochain

各位OKB的伙伴們,大家好:忙碌的4月已經過去,新一期OKB生態建設月報如期與大家見面了。在過去的一個月里,OKB生態建設的各個維度均取得了很大進展.

1900/1/1 0:00:00
星球前線 | 擊敗黃金!比特幣成為2020年最賺錢投資_比特幣:USDT

Odaily星球日報譯者|念銀思唐摘要:-比特幣目前是2020年表現最好的資產,自年初以來上漲了22.4%。-黃金也表現良好,盡管在3月份遭受嚴重損失,但今年迄今仍上漲9.5%.

1900/1/1 0:00:00
官方推出Filecoin Discover數據集硬盤項目_OIN:COI

免責聲明:將技術概念從一種語言完美地翻譯到另一種語言是困難的,因此請注意,我們不能保證這個翻譯的準確性.

1900/1/1 0:00:00
NDN的互聯網信息高速最后一公里_NDN:BTCPEP

“任何一個學生,不論他在地球的哪一個角落,都能夠隨時坐在他書房里的投影儀邊,閱讀所有的書和文件,這些投影和原件一模一樣,毫無二致.

1900/1/1 0:00:00
ads